I'm hoping you can help. I know you've got a ton of other things to do, but if you get a moment, here's the problem. It's regarding the "sign up for newsletter" check box:
If I set the default display to show the box as checked, when the user creates an account, unchecking it still inserts a value of 1 in the customers_newsletter field.
However, if I set the default display to show the box as unchecked, then it works as it should (checking is inserts a 1 and leaving it unchecked inserts a 0).

Opera 9 don't show vertical dotlines
To fix this problem add
padding:0 1px;
to css .vDotLine
